Transaction 0e634ca49b29ed6f6066c7c04f30b5a458107fefb1973ee63035e879626d2255

2 Input
1 Outputs
  • 0e634ca49b29ed6f6066c7c04f30b5a458107fefb1973ee63035e879626d2255:0
  • value  28994509
    address  1Fmkq8HDze5YWin8UZyNURGBx5g9aEeeGi